Cheese and cracker trays, fruit, and grazing boards
Cheese and cracker plates look simple till they sit on a table for 2 hours and become a wilted grid of beige. The good ones travel in layers, with crackers on the side to protect crunch, and they arrive with room‑temperature assistance. A cheese and crackers tray gain from 3 textures: a soft cheese, a semi‑firm, and a hard, plus something salted and something sweet. A thoughtful party cheese and cracker tray in Arkansas might combine sharp cheddar, Ozark Mountain goat, and Manchego with regional honey, toasted pecans, and apple slices.
If you order a cheese and cracker tray for 20, presume it reasonably feeds 12 to 15 as a primary snack. Add a fruit tray or 2 for color and hydration. A cracker and cheese tray for workplace grazing stands up better than a delicate charcuterie board if individuals will come and go over several hours. For a cheese & & cracker tray at a wedding event rehearsal, consider personnel service or a smaller sized display screen revitalized frequently. Large grazing tables look fantastic for photos, then typically become traffic bottlenecks.
Vendors utilize different names for the same thing. You will see cheese and cracker platters, cracker platter, crackers tray, and cheese trays. The questions to ask: how many ounces of cheese per person, what crackers hold up, and whether the fruit is fresh cut within four hours of service.
Breakfast that does not slow down your start time
Breakfast catering Fayetteville design frequently suggests hearty, however that does not have to indicate heavy. A breakfast platter that mixes protein and produce leaves you with fewer leftovers and less slump by 10 a.m. Mini quiche travel well and reheat rapidly if a conference runs long. Breakfast platters with biscuits, eggs, and bacon need chafers, which just work if you have table space and 20 minutes for setup.
If you are catering north Fayetteville for a 7:30 a.m. security instruction, insist on a shipment window that lands 15 minutes before your start. The majority of breakfast catering failures are timing failures. Yogurt parfaits sweat if they sit too long, while breakfast sandwiches dry out when held exposed. Boxed breakfast works when individuals are moving to various spaces, but a single breakfast platter that everybody hits in one pass can be faster.
Hot buffet fundamentals: potatoes, pasta, and salvageable leftovers
Baked potato catering has a faithful following here. It is uncomplicated, affordable, and people can customize without decreasing the line. The distinction between a satisfying baked potato bar catering setup and a soft, uncreative one is all about holding temp and toppings. Keep proteins over 140 degrees, sour cream and cheese listed below 41 degrees, and location greens far from steam. Baked potatoes and salad catering set well when the schedule is hazy, because both can ride for a short delay without disaster.
Pasta, like baked linguine, requires a tighter window. Demand a little undercooked pasta so it does not turn mushy during transit. If your location is five floors up with unreliable freight elevators, schedule a staging table on the lobby level and ferry in waves. These small logistics calls save quality as much as flavor.
On leftovers, Fayetteville places vary in their rules. If you plan to take food back to the office, pick items that preserve integrity: boxed lunches, sealed sandwiches, cookies, fruit, and unopened beverage pairings. Hot creamy sauces typically do not reheat well.

Budget mathematics without the fluff
Pricing relocations with protein costs and labor. For Fayetteville catering, anticipate boxed lunches in the 12 to 18 dollar variety per individual for basic sandwiches, a bit more for premium proteins or allergy‑friendly builds. Party trays differ widely. A generous cheese and cracker platter for 20 can run 75 to 140 dollars depending on cheese choice. Breakfast platters with eggs and meat land around 10 to 16 per individual, while pastry‑only spreads run less.
Delivery charges range from 10 to 40 dollars locally, or they are waived over a minimum. Chafing setups often incur a rental cost if you do not return frames. If your occasion runs long and staff stay to tend lines, spending plan hourly service. The sly expense is disposables. Compostable ware adds a dollar or more per head. You pay for it, but workplaces value the upgrade.

When barbecue is the brief
People ask whether bbq delivery Fayetteville counts as catering. It does if the supplier can part properly and send sufficient sides. The key with barbecue is wetness and timing. Pulled pork will carry, but sliced brisket dries quick unless it is jam-packed right. If you roll with barbecue for a workplace, do not avoid the salad. An extra pan of slaw and beans helps balance plates and slows the sprint to the meat tray.
For weddings that want a barbecue line, buckle down about line management. Replicate proteins on both sides, set buns at both ends, and pre‑slice pickles so they do not clump. A couple of tongs and clear signage can move 100 individuals in under 15 minutes.
